Transaction 421fbfd7a1ac7446005f8073e52dd18a3d08fc5503ea098855c811c397a0844b

1 Input
2 Outputs
  • 421fbfd7a1ac7446005f8073e52dd18a3d08fc5503ea098855c811c397a0844b:0
  • value  22071827
    address  2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
  • 421fbfd7a1ac7446005f8073e52dd18a3d08fc5503ea098855c811c397a0844b:1
  • value  383371
    address  n1fGfxUeLLcnuUkgpBQHr7N3i6iBpK9C8H